如何调整Graphite以不丢弃数据点?

时间:2015-07-30 20:17:18

标签: graphite

我有一个石墨实例,每分钟的指标超过10万。有些服务器的指标存在差距,有些则没有。单个服务器的某些指标存在很多差距,其他服务器的差距很小或没有。

差距似乎非常有节奏。例如,以1 /秒发送CPU,它将发送7,丢弃3,发送7,丢弃4,来回。当我每10秒钟发送一次时,它大约每3分钟就丢一次(18个数据点)。

由于节奏因公制而异,从服务器到服务器,我觉得很难将碳缓存归咎于缺失的指标。如果数据进入太快,为什么丢弃的指标不会在所有指标中均匀分布?此外,计算机甚至没有真正的汗水,磁盘也不是那么忙。

我的问题是:

  • 如何证明钻石收藏家是否(或没有)发送所有数据点?
  • 如何让碳告诉我它已经丢弃了数据点(如果有的话)?
  • 我需要在石墨服务器上测量什么才能知道何时无法获取更多指标?

更新:

我了解到为了证明钻石收藏家工作正常,我可以通过输入

在前台运行它
diamond -f -l

我还发现有些错误没有进入日志。当我禁用有问题的收藏家时,如果没有消除,差距会缩小。

0 个答案:

没有答案